It's like a car wreck - you just can't look away. The latest from Joey Q on this:

 

NRAMA: Joe, Onslaught Reborn…you’ve got one day left, but…just to clarify, this isn’t an April Fool’s thing?

 

JQ: Nope, it’s been in the works for some time now.

 

NRAMA: Anything you’d like to add to what Jeph Loeb, Rob Liefeld, and John Barber told us earlier this week?

 

JQ: Nothing more than it’s going to a fun project and judging by the fan reaction so far, Rob still seems to be the most magnetic guy in comics. Doesn’t matter what he does; the boy brings a crowd with him. No slight to Jeph - who is I believe the stickiest man in comics - but regardless, the outcome is the same, Loeb and Liefeld know how to get people talking.

 

NRAMA: On a scale of 1 to 10 (with 1 being the lowest and 10 being the highest), rank for us the scale, or importance of some of your recent big events in relation to one another… JQ: Sorry I can’t do that. Each of these projects is important and how I feel may not be how a fan feels. If you love cosmic stuff then Annihilation is going to be more important to you than Civil War. If you’re a die-hard Hulk fan then there’s nothing bigger than Planet Hulk this year. We’ve tried to offer up a little something for everyone, so I can’t really pick.

 

NRAMA: No doubt the project [Onslaught Reborn] is going to benefit a very good cause, but with the Squadron Supreme-verse crossing over with the Ultimate Universe, and the New Universe returning and now the Heroes Reborn world or dimension coming back, any concerns about too many universes ruining the stew, so to speak?

 

JQ: Only if the projects aren’t good. That’s the bottom line. The same question could have been asked when we launched the Ultimate Universe or later Supreme Power/Squadron Supreme. Fans migrate towards quality; it’s as simple as that. Give them something great to read and talk about and all will end up just fine. That said, the onus is on us to make sure these projects are the best they can be.

 

NRAMA: At the same time, does everything need a revisitation? Secret Wars, Onslaught, and even the Clone Saga is getting a nod in Ultimate Spider-Man…why the looking back?

 

JQ: You forgot Avengers: Disassembled, which we’re revisiting after Civil War. But, in the case of Secret Wars and the upcoming Ultimate Clone Saga and Disassemble, we’re merely borrowing the names from these stories. Let’s face it, Bendis and Del’Otto’s Secret Wars had nothing to do with the original. So, I guess you can say we’re using familiar names as marketing hooks, but they’re certainly not a look back in any way. Onslaught Reborn on the other hand is a revisiting to that Universe and Jeph and Rob doing some unfinished business.

 

NRAMA: Interesting choice of words as diehard comic news fans and early Newsarama readers may recall “Unfinished Business” is how Heroes Reborn was originally referred to.

You know...I'm looking forward to these comics. It's a guilty pleasure watching Liefeld's art progress over an issue. The inconsistency from panel to panel beats a Where's Waldo book any day. You definitely get your money's worth over a typical Modern comic that you can read in 5 minutes and toss in the box. You could spend an hour finding all the goofs...

 

Here's an example...Youngblood Strikefile #1

 

Page #1 - What you see here are the Allies. The girl is named Glory. The flying guy is Super-Patriot, and the Captain America clone in the middle is Die-Hard. The set-up is they are running into a battle with the Nazis during World War II. Note a couple of items. DH has a bag mask over his head and load bearing gear (LBG) on both legs, his shoulders, his chest, and ammo pouches along his belt. SP has a star on his red head band and an eagle across his whole chest and belly.

 

yspage1.jpg

 

Page #2/3 - DH now has a full fitting mask on and his shoulder/chest straps are gone. Note the LBG on his right leg. SP has the eagle on his chest but it doesn't run down the front. His mask is now blue. Also, note Glory's red boots.

 

yspage2.jpg

 

Page #4 - DH shoulder/chest straps reappear and the LBG gear is now on his left leg in the top panel and missing completely from the lower left panel. At least the mask hasn't changed. Glory now has straps on her boots.

 

yspage4.jpg

 

Page #5 - SP's eagle now is along the whole front of his costume.

 

yspage5.jpg

 

Page #6 - DH's LBG gear and straps are gone.

 

yspage7.jpg

 

Page #9 - DH's shoulder straps disappear. Leg strap now on left leg. And are they now fighting at night?

 

yspage8.jpg

 

Page #9 - DH's now has the bag mask on. Glory has lost the strapping on her boots.

 

yspage9.jpg

 

And there you have it. You know what they say about a movie being so bad that it's entertaining? Well, trying to find all the continuity glitches in this issue, or any issue Liefeld draws, makes for some great reading. smirk.gif
